The Tamiya 58318 brings the excitement of the renowned Team Vodafone AMG-Mercedes to the RC world, featuring the adaptable TT-01 chassis. Known for its ease of assembly and extensive upgrade options, the TT-01 is a favorite among hobbyists looking to customize their ride for optimal performance.
The real-world counterpart of this model, the Team Vodafone AMG-Mercedes, has a storied legacy in the DTM (Deutsche Tourenwagen Masters). After securing back-to-back championships in 2000 and 2001, driver Bernd Schneider narrowly missed out in 2002 but returned triumphantly in 2003. This RC model captures the spirit of that championship-winning car.
The TT-01 chassis is celebrated for its straightforward design, making it accessible for both beginners and seasoned builders. With a four-wheel shaft drive and a 540 motor, this model offers a smooth yet powerful driving experience. The chassis supports a range of upgrades, allowing enthusiasts to tweak performance to their liking.
One of the standout features of the TT-01 is its compatibility with numerous optional parts. From suspension tweaks to motor upgrades, the possibilities are nearly endless. This flexibility makes it a versatile platform for those who love to experiment with different setups.
